**Mail room relocation.** As of this quarter, the Hartleby Campus mail room has moved from the ground floor of the Fenwick Building to Basement Level 1 of the Orchard Annex. All incoming parcels and internal post are now handled there between 09:00 and 17:00. New starters collecting welcome packs should go directly to the Annex. Entry to the basement corridor requires the door code below.

staff pass of bajeg-tajep = bdg-UCDGI-52819

- [ ] Step 12 — Hot-reload verification (support team). After the custodians rotate the Brindlecore signing key, confirm the configuration hot-reload propagates to all Osselton edge nodes without a restart. Verify checksum parity in the reload log, note any node requiring manual intervention, and record timestamps in the ceremony ledger. To unseal the verification vault for this step, enter the recovery passphrase directly below.

strongbox words: aldax-istox-sorion-isteth-gilion-tamius-norok-aldax-fraox-wenius

- [ ] Step 7: Archive cold storage buckets (Glacierline tier). Confirm both ceremony witnesses are present, verify bucket manifests match the Oxbow ledger, then seal the archive key shares. Plugin authors may observe but not handle shares. Once sealed, the archive index itself is encrypted and can only be reopened with the passphrase below.

vault phrase of badup-hahig = tamael-aldael-kelmir-istael-fenok-istwyn-tamius-jorath-oliion

14:32 — Offline sync in TrailNote finally came back for crews in the Verran Basin pilot. Turns out the cache purge job was wiping queued survey forms before upload, not after. Marisol shipped a hotfix and confirmed queued entries now survive restarts. If a customer reports lost forms from this window, ask them to read you the token shown on their sync screen.

session token of tajef-bageg = htk21_5d90d574934f3ccae6437